Story consent terms

YOUR STORY IS NOT OUR INVENTORY.

These plain-language terms describe the V1 story process. The actual submission packet must capture the contributor’s choices and written approval before any material is published.

Before you send material

  • Request the packet first. Do not email your story, medical records, insurance documents, passwords, or sensitive identifiers.
  • Share only content you created or have permission to provide.
  • Do not identify or disclose private information about relatives, clinicians, employers, schools, or other people without appropriate permission.
  • Do not submit copyrighted photographs merely because you appear in them; the photographer or rights holder may own the copyright.

Your publication choices

The packet should allow full name, first-name-only, or approved pseudonym publication; location precision; image choices; accessibility descriptions; story category; and contact preference. TeamCrohns may decline a submission that cannot be published safely or accurately.

Editing and medical boundaries

TeamCrohns may edit for clarity, length, privacy, structure, accessibility, medical-claim boundaries, legal risk, and house style. It will not knowingly turn a contributor’s meaning into a treatment endorsement or miracle claim. The contributor receives the proposed final story and images for review.

Final approval

Nothing is published until the contributor gives written final approval to the exact edited material and identifies any approved photographs. Silence is not approval.

Permission to publish

The contributor grants TeamCrohns a nonexclusive, worldwide, royalty-free permission to reproduce, edit, format, display, distribute, archive, and promote the approved material in connection with TeamCrohns and the identified campaign or editorial package. The contributor keeps ownership of their original material unless a separate written agreement states otherwise.

No payment or medical endorsement

Unless a separate written agreement states otherwise, submission is voluntary and unpaid. Publication does not mean TeamCrohns endorses any product, provider, treatment, diagnosis, claim, or outcome described.

Corrections and withdrawal

A contributor may request correction or withdrawal by emailing [email protected]. TeamCrohns will make reasonable efforts to correct or remove material it controls after verifying the request. It cannot guarantee removal from search caches, archives, screenshots, social shares, reposts, or other third-party copies.

Privacy limits

Publication makes approved material public. Even a pseudonym may not prevent recognition. Contributors should consider future employment, insurance, family, safety, and personal consequences before approving publication.
